Abstract

An air massage device (1) comprises a component (30)fixed though winding around a massage portion, air bags (41, 42) arranged on the component (30), and a heater (70) heating up the massage portion.

Background technology
Patent documentation 1 discloses an example of pneumatic massage device.This pneumatic massage device have accessory longitudinally on two air bags of configuration.And, by expansion and the contraction of two air bags, massage position is massaged.
Patent documentation 1: TOHKEMY 2011-67289 communique
Summary of the invention
the problem that invention will solve
In general, the effect of massage is along with the blood flow at massage position becomes unimpeded and uprises.But patent documentation 1 is not mentioned and is promoted the blood flow at massage position to improve the effect of massage.In addition, the blood flow that the pneumatic massage device of patent documentation 1 does not possess promotion massage position is to improve the structure of the effect of massage.
The object of the present invention is to provide a kind of pneumatic massage device that can improve the effect of massage.
